掌握微信小程序开发:学习Demo项目源码解析
需积分: 1 128 浏览量
更新于2024-11-02
收藏 64KB ZIP 举报
资源摘要信息:"本资源是一套名为‘学习Demo’的微信小程序项目源码,具体名称为‘wechat-app-xiaoyima-master’。项目包含了小程序开发的完整代码和资源文件,可作为学习和参考使用。文件列表中包含了项目的主要文件压缩包‘wechat-app-xiaoyima-master.zip’,以及一个说明文件‘说明.zip’。从提供的信息来看,这些文件应该包含微信小程序项目的框架代码、前端界面设计、后端逻辑处理、数据接口交互等关键部分,开发者可以借此了解小程序开发的基本结构和开发流程。标签中的‘软件/插件’、‘小程序’和‘微信’表明这是一个面向微信平台的小程序开发项目资源,开发者需具备微信小程序开发的相关知识,包括对微信开发者工具的使用、小程序的框架理解以及微信API的调用等。"
知识点详细说明:
1. 小程序项目结构:微信小程序项目通常包含前端文件(WXML、WXSS、JS)、配置文件(JSON)以及可能的后端服务代码。前端文件负责定义用户界面和交互逻辑,配置文件用于设置窗口外观、导航条样式等,后端服务代码负责处理数据存储、业务逻辑以及与服务器的通信。
2. 微信小程序框架:微信小程序有自己的框架和运行时环境,开发者需要遵守微信小程序的开发规范。这包括页面的生命周期函数、组件的使用、事件的绑定和处理、数据绑定以及页面跳转等。
3. 微信开发者工具:要开发微信小程序,必须使用微信官方提供的开发者工具进行代码编写、预览和调试。该工具支持代码编辑、真机调试、代码压缩和语法检查等功能。
4. 微信API使用:微信小程序可以调用微信提供的各种API进行功能扩展,例如获取用户信息、使用微信支付、分享到朋友圈等。开发者需要熟悉这些API的使用方法和限制。
5. 数据存储与后端交互:微信小程序支持本地存储(如使用`wx.setStorage`、`wx.getStorage`等API)和服务器存储(通过网络请求与后端服务进行数据交互)。开发者需要了解前后端数据交互的方法和常见问题处理。
6. 前端界面设计:小程序的界面设计要适应微信的用户体验,包括页面布局、色彩搭配、文字排版等。需要运用WXML和WXSS进行页面布局和样式设计,以及使用JavaScript处理交互逻辑。
7. 项目部署和发布:开发完成后,开发者需要将项目部署到服务器上,并通过微信小程序的管理后台提交审核。审核通过后,小程序才能发布上线供用户使用。
根据文件名称列表,开发者还需要注意文件的解压缩和组织结构,确保所有相关文件和资源都能正确使用。在学习和开发过程中,应当参考‘说明.zip’中的文件,以获取更详细的指导和项目描述。
2024-05-22 上传
2024-09-18 上传
2021-11-12 上传
2023-12-19 上传
2024-06-11 上传
2024-06-11 上传
2023-06-14 上传
2023-03-01 上传
Java资深学姐
- 粉丝: 4052
- 资源: 1046
最新资源
- lianjia-spider:链家二手房爬虫,支持爬取指定城市,户型,价位二手仓库,并通过电子提供跨平台UI,可记录历史价格,售出仓库等信息
- NetCDF数据在ArcMap中的使用
- spark-ifs:使用Apache Spark在大型数据集上基于迭代过滤器的特征选择
- quazip 压缩解压库 qt c++
- my-max-gps
- elastic
- 图像相似度识别比较案例
- WuBinCPP-MCU_Font_Release-master.zip
- eslint-plugin-no-es2015:一些禁用es2015的eslint规则
- 购物
- DotNetHomeWork:武汉大学周三上软件构造基础作业仓库
- linkedin-clone:LinkedIn Clone由React和Redux制作
- 实用数据分析:利用python进行数据分析
- Noobi:一个执行Shellcode的简单工具,能够检测鼠标移动
- Codecademy项目:学习数据科学时完成的项目
- separator-escape